Discord – одна из самых популярных платформ для коммуникации геймеров и обычных пользователей. Она позволяет создавать серверы, где можно общаться посредством текстовых сообщений, голосовых или видеозвонков. Одним из уникальных возможностей Discord является возможность создания и настройки собственного бота.
Боты представляют собой компьютерные программы, которые автоматизируют определенные задачи на сервере Discord. Они могут выполнять роль модератора, музыкального плеера, автоматического ответчика и многого другого. Создание и настройка бота может показаться сложной задачей для новичков, но на самом деле это довольно просто, если следовать пошаговой инструкции.
В этой статье мы расскажем, как создать и настроить бота на сервере Discord. Мы рассмотрим все необходимые шаги, начиная от создания приложения на сайте разработчиков Discord, до добавления бота на сервер и настройки его функционала. Следуя нашей инструкции, вы сможете создать своего собственного бота и использовать его для автоматизации различных задач на вашем сервере Discord.
Шаг 1: Регистрация аккаунта на Discord
Discord — это популярная платформа для общения геймеров с возможностью создания и настройки ботов. Чтобы начать использовать Discord и создать своего бота, необходимо зарегистрироваться на платформе.
- Перейдите на официальный сайт Discord по адресу https://discord.com/.
- Нажмите на кнопку «Зарегистрироваться» в правом верхнем углу страницы.
- В появившемся окне введите свой адрес электронной почты, придумайте и введите пароль для аккаунта и нажмите кнопку «Продолжить».
- Заполните необходимые поля, такие как имя пользователя и дата рождения, и нажмите кнопку «Продолжить».
- Подтвердите создание аккаунта, следуя инструкциям, полученным на вашу электронную почту.
- После подтверждения аккаунта вы будете перенаправлены на страницу Discord.
Теперь у вас есть зарегистрированный аккаунт на Discord, который вы можете использовать для создания и настройки бота на сервере Discord. Переходите к следующему шагу для более подробной инструкции по созданию бота.
Шаг 2: Создание нового сервера на Discord
Если вы еще не имеете своего сервера на платформе Discord, вам необходимо создать его перед тем, как начать создание и настройку вашего бота. Создание нового сервера на Discord очень просто:
Откройте приложение Discord и войдите в свою учетную запись.
В левой панели выберите иконку плюса (+) рядом с названием текущего сервера.
В появившемся окне выберите «Создать сервер».
Введите название для вашего нового сервера и выберите его регион.
Нажмите на кнопку «Создать» и ваш новый сервер будет создан.
Поздравляю! Теперь у вас есть свой собственный сервер на Discord, на котором вы сможете создать и настроить своего бота.
Шаг 3: Установка и настройка бота на сервере
После создания и получения токена для вашего бота, вы можете приступить к установке и настройке бота на сервере Discord. В этом разделе мы рассмотрим несколько шагов, которые позволят вам успешно установить и настроить бота на вашем сервере.
- Откройте Discord и войдите в свой аккаунт.
- Создайте новый сервер или выберите существующий, на котором вы хотите установить бота.
- Перейдите в раздел «Настройки сервера» путем нажатия на название сервера в левой части экрана и выберите «Настройки сервера» из выпадающего меню.
- В меню слева выберите «Управление ботами».
- Нажмите кнопку «Добавить бота», а затем введите токен, полученный при создании бота.
- После добавления бота вы можете настроить его различные параметры, такие как имя бота, аватар и разрешения.
- Чтобы добавить бота на свой сервер, перейдите в раздел «Настройки сервера» и выберите «Интеграции». Поискайте своего бота в списке и нажмите «Пригласить».
- Выберите нужный сервер, на который вы хотите добавить бота, и нажмите «Продолжить».
- Подтвердите роль и разрешения бота на вашем сервере, нажав «Авторизовать».
- Поздравляю, вы успешно установили и настроили бота на своем сервере Discord! Теперь вы можете начать использовать его для автоматизации различных задач и создания интерактивных функций на вашем сервере.
Обратите внимание, что при установке и настройке бота на сервере необходимо соблюдать правила Discord и не злоупотреблять возможностями бота. Убедитесь, что вы имеете все необходимые разрешения и разрешения сервера для добавления и настройки бота. Кроме того, предоставление боту разрешений может повлечь за собой риски, связанные с безопасностью, поэтому будьте осторожны и следуйте рекомендациям Discord по безопасному использованию ботов.
Шаг 4: Получение токена для бота
После создания приложения и настройки бота в Discord Developer Portal, необходимо получить токен, который будет использоваться для авторизации вашего бота на серверах Discord.
Для получения токена выполните следующие шаги:
- Перейдите в раздел «Bot» в меню слева и нажмите на кнопку «Add Bot».
- В появившемся окне подтвердите создание бота, нажав «Yes, do it!».
- Под названием вашего бота появится его аватарка и токен.
- Чтобы скопировать токен, нажмите на кнопку «Copy» рядом с ним.
Важно: Токен вашего бота является секретным и конфиденциальным ключом, поэтому не обнародуйте его нигде и не делитесь им с посторонними.
Теперь, когда у вас есть токен для вашего бота, вы можете использовать его для авторизации и выполнения различных действий на серверах Discord.
Шаг 5: Написание кода для бота на языке программирования
После того, как вы создали своего бота на сервере Discord и настроили его, вы можете приступить к написанию кода для бота. Для этого вам понадобится знание какого-либо языка программирования – наиболее распространеными являются JavaScript и Python.
1. Если вы выбрали JavaScript, вам понадобится установить Node.js на свой компьютер. Node.js – это среда выполнения JavaScript, которая позволяет запускать код на стороне сервера. Вы можете скачать и установить Node.js с официального сайта разработчика.
2. Создайте новый файл с кодом для вашего бота. Назовите его bot.js, index.js или как вам больше нравится. В начале файла добавьте импорт необходимых модулей – discord.js для взаимодействия с Discord API.
const Discord = require('discord.js');
const client = new Discord.Client();
3. Напишите код, который определит, что произойдет после запуска бота. Например, вы можете добавить функцию, которая выводит в консоль сообщение о том, что бот успешно запущен.
client.on('ready', () => {
console.log('Бот успешно запущен!');
});
4. Создайте обработчики событий для различных типов сообщений и действий, которые может совершать ваш бот. Например, вы можете добавить обработчик для команды «!ping», которая будет отвечать на сообщение и отправлять обратно «Pong!».
client.on('message', message => {
if (message.content === '!ping') {
message.reply('Pong!');
}
});
5. Добавьте код, который будет авторизовывать вашего бота на сервере Discord. Для этого вам понадобится токен вашего бота, который вы получили на предыдущем шаге. Вставьте его в указанное место в коде.
client.login('токен_вашего_бота');
6. Наконец, запустите вашего бота, выполнив команду запуска кода в командной строке. Введите команду «node bot.js» или «node index.js», в зависимости от названия вашего файла с кодом.
Вот и все! Теперь ваш бот настроен и готов к использованию на сервере Discord. Вы можете добавить больше функциональности, написав дополнительный код, и настроить его поведение по своему усмотрению. Успехов в создании вашего бота!
Шаг 6: Запуск и тестирование бота на сервере
После того, как вы добавили бота на сервер и настроили необходимые разрешения, вы можете приступить к запуску и тестированию бота.
- Убедитесь, что ваш бот получил все необходимые разрешения, чтобы выполнять команды и отправлять сообщения на сервере Discord. Проверьте, что вы дали боту права на чтение, отправку сообщений, управление ролями и пр. Если вам нужно изменить разрешения, вы можете сделать это в настройках сервера.
- Перейдите к консоли разработчика Discord, где вы создали своего бота.
- Нажмите на кнопку «Включить бота», чтобы активировать вашего бота и разрешить ему присоединиться к серверу.
- Скопируйте токен вашего бота и сохраните его в безопасном месте. Данный токен необходим для подключения вашего бота к серверу.
- На своем компьютере или сервере откройте терминал или командную строку и перейдите в директорию, в которой находится ваш бот.
- Запустите вашего бота, выполнив следующую команду:
node имяФайла.js
, где «имяФайла.js» — это название файла, содержащего код вашего бота. Например,node bot.js
.
После запуска бота он должен подключиться к вашему серверу Discord и быть готовым к использованию.
Чтобы протестировать работу вашего бота, перейдите на ваш сервер Discord и попробуйте выполнить команды, которые вы настроили в коде вашего бота.
Если ваш бот не работает или возникают ошибки, вам могут потребоваться дополнительные настройки или исправления в коде. Проверьте свой код на наличие синтаксических ошибок и проблем с подключением к серверу.
Команда | Описание |
---|---|
!пинг | Отправляет обратно сообщение с задержкой между отправкой и ответом бота. |
!помощь | Отправляет пользователю список доступных команд бота и их описание. |
!привет | Бот отправляет приветственное сообщение. |
!информация | Бот отправляет информацию о сервере и подключенных пользователях. |
При тестировании бота рекомендуется обратить внимание на работу всех функций, проверить корректность выводимых сообщений и команд, а также убедиться в отсутствии ошибок. Если вы обнаружите проблемы, попробуйте найти решение в документации Discord API или обратитесь за поддержкой к разработчикам бота или сообществу.
Как только вы протестировали бота и убедились в его правильной работе, вы готовы распространять его среди других пользователей или добавить дополнительные функции на своем сервере Discord.